REVIEW OF EXPO HOTEL IN VALENCIA

by JULIA RICO
(Malaga, Andalucia)

I stayed at the Expo quite recently - a large hotel situated on a busy main road. Even though it is a big hotel, it has a very friendly atmosphere - everyone says hello and was always happy to help. The rooms are clean, large and airy. It is great value for money too - be sure to get breakfast included with the hotel. It was also very peaceful for such a large hotel due to the soundproofing and I was never disturbed during the entire stay. This is also surprising considering that the hotel is situated in a vibrant, busy area. That’s another great thing - the hotel is practically connected to a massive department store with supermarket - El Corte Ingles (a long-established chain). There are also lots of places to eat and shop nearby.

The old town is just a 10 minute walk away - visit the trendy Barrio del Carmen (full of bars and clubs) and all the old squares (plazas)- you will get to see all the historical landmarks that make Valencia so special.

There is a metro station and lots of buses available right outside the hotel. The staff were happy to help with directions and had plenty of tourist information. Other places of interest are Colon (a great shopping area) which is a bus ride away (or you can walk to it via el Carmen).

You can also go a little further and get to Cabanyal - you’ll find a lovely long sandy beach here full of cafes and restaurants.

This is a great hotel and I had a relaxed, enjoyable stay. I’ll definitely be back soon! By the way, there’s a fantastic swimming pool on the roof of the hotel with fantastic views of Valencia!
